quote:
Originally posted by doctorspin:
The wickets will probably suit the nurdlers of Colly and Bell.

The wickets are something of an unkown quantity, many being newly laid.

If they play slow and a bit low SA may be disadvantaged on both batting and bowling fronts. Oz may struggle a bit more with their big strokeplayers who like pace. BLee's pace may be nullified and seen as tasty pies.

If the wickets are unsettled as a result of being newly laid then there may be a lot of gripping low-scoring matches.

I think ATM the WC is as wide open as it could be.


The wickets are a real puzzlement to me. I am from Trinidad in the WI of course and to think that WI since the lory days of the 70's/early 80s have never had wickets conducive to their style of players. Even with Walsh, Bishop and Ambrose in their prime, the wickets were always somewhat slow. Now, consider that WI has called on NO specialist spinners for the team , that doesnt lead me to think that the wickets will be for spin. However, I know the grouds well enough to know that they are enever aprticulalry hard or fast pitches.

Concerning the classification of WI as minnows? I really dont see how this can be. Yes we have been woefully inconsistent in tests, but the team is a bit better at one days. Plus, we have a pretty good batting lineup once they can gel. Solid upper order batsmen, and the unkown quanitity in this young man Kieron Pollard in the middle. Hes a HUGE hitter, basically a Shahid Afridi with aim.
You have to consider the depth of the windies batting, yes we have a bob tail I think if the upper order batting holds up we should be fine. Chris gayle, marlon samuels, lara at 3, or sarwan, then chanderpaul, pollard, bravo , thats 7 accomplished batsmen in any order that they see firt. Hopefully the tail can put on just 10 runs each...
